The Art of Matching Select Porcelain Restorations to Anterior Teeth in Bellevue,WA
0 Comments Published November 9th, 2007 in Porcelain RestorationsIntroduction
Matching a single central incisor is challenging but possible if the dentist and ceramist understand the principles of natural oral esthetics; good tissue health and perfectly reflected tooth contours at the midline are just as important as the actual color of the teeth.
